November Weather in Idaho Falls, United States

Last updated: June 24, 2025

In November, the average temperature in Idaho Falls, United States hovers around 2°C (36°F). Expect a chilly atmosphere with temperatures dipping as low as -13°C (9°F) and occasionally reaching a warm 21°C (70°F). Be prepared for a bit of wet weather too, with an average precipitation of 32 mm (1.3 in) spread over 9 days. Don't forget, the air is quite humid, with an average humidity level of 86%.

How November Weather in Idaho Falls Compares to Other Months

Weather in Idaho Falls varies notably across the year, with each month offering distinct climate conditions. This page compares November’s weather to other months in Idaho Falls, focusing on differences in temperature, rainfall, humidity, and UV levels.

This table compares monthly weather conditions in Idaho Falls, showing how November’s temperature, precipitation, humidity, and UV index levels differ from those of other months.
 TemperaturePrecipitationHumidityUV
January Weather-5°C (24°F)40 mm (1.6 inches)95%moderate
February Weather-3°C (27°F)48 mm (1.9 inches)95%moderate
March Weather3°C (37°F)43 mm (1.7 inches)90%high
April Weather7°C (45°F)55 mm (2.2 inches)81%very high
May Weather12°C (54°F)58 mm (2.3 inches)71%very high
June Weather18°C (65°F)31 mm (1.2 inches)64%extreme
July Weather23°C (74°F)11 mm (0.4 inches)59%extreme
August Weather21°C (71°F)16 mm (0.6 inches)49%very high
September Weather16°C (61°F)26 mm (1.0 inches)52%very high
October Weather7°C (45°F)39 mm (1.5 inches)69%high
November Weather2°C (36°F)32 mm (1.3 inches)86%moderate
December Weather-4°C (26°F)41 mm (1.6 inches)91%moderate
